I have a 70lbs tv 27inch for my cab. I have the cab from the Project Arcade book (Lucid style). My monitor shelf has about a 14-15 degree angle on it. COuld I just rest the TV against the back part of the cab, aka the upper back section? Or should I put some wood in there to prevent it from sliding around? I won't be moving the cab once the TV is in there.
Does anyone just have it where the TV is in there? With no big support wood?

I used an old console TV screen for my first cabinet, and ended up cutting the bezel out of the front of the set, since it already had solid mounting spots for the tube, then screwed the top and bottom of the bezel into 2x4's I ran across the cabinet.
After the, I remounted the screen, solid as a rock.
